Macmillan Cancer Support would like to extend a huge thank you and well done to everyone who took part in the World's Biggest Coffee Morning this year

A lot of hard work and imagination went into organising some amazing events all over the county and all the effort (and baking) has really paid off.

Coffee mornings in Pembrokeshire have so far raised over £9,000 and money is still coming in!

Sue Reece, fund-raising manager, said: "We are thrilled with how World's Biggest Coffee Morning has gone this year, I am astounded by the level of commitment and hard work that all of our supporters have put in to making this year's World's Biggest Coffee Morning an even bigger success than last year.

"We'd like to thank everyone who took part and a big thank you to Chevron for launching the event in Pembrokeshire this year."

The World's Biggest Coffee Morning was a huge success all over South West Wales this year with nearly 500 events in total and money still counted and final totals eagerly anticipated.

All of the money raised will be going towards all of the brilliant services and professionals which Macmillan funds.

As well as the well-known nurses, there are Macmillan occupational therapists, welfare benefits advisers, pharmacists and physiotherapist who all support people affected by cancer in Wales.

The money raised will go towards improving the lives of people with cancer and help them to gain access to the best possible services and support.
